Human herpesvirus 8 (HHV-8), or Kaposi's sarcoma-associated herpesvirus, is a gammaherpesvirus first detected in Kaposi's sarcoma tumor cells and subsequently in primary effusion lymphoma (PEL) tumor cells and peripheral blood mononuclear cells from PEL patients. PEL has been recognized as an individual nosologic entity based on its distinctive features and consistent association with HHV-8 infection. PEL is an unusual form of body cavity-based B-cell lymphoma (BCBL). It occurs predominantly in human
immunodeficiency
virus (HIV)-positive patients but occasionally also in elderly HIV-negative patients. We describe a case of PEL, with ascites, bilateral pleural effusions, and a small axillary lymphadenopathy, in a 72-year-old HIV-negative man. PCR performed on a lymph node specimen and in liquid effusion was positive for HHV-8 and negative for Epstein-Barr virus. The immunophenotype of the neoplastic cells was B CD19+ CD20+ CD22+ with coexpression of
CD10
and CD23 and with clonal kappa light chain rearrangement. The patient was treated with Rituximab, a chimeric (human-mouse) anti-CD20 monoclonal antibody. Thirteen months later, the patient continued in clinical remission. This is the first report of an HHV-8-associated BCBL in an HIV-negative patient in Argentina.

Primary effusion lymphoma (PEL) or body cavity-based lymphoma (BCBL) is a unique subgroup of B-cell lymphomas that exhibits exclusive or dominant involvement of serous body cavities without a detectable tumor mass. We present a case of a PEL/BCBL that exclusively involved the peritoneal cavity of a 58-year-old immunocompetent male with hepatitis C virus (HCV)-related liver cirrhosis. The lymphoma cells were large, highly atypical and expressed CD19, CD20, CD22,
CD10
, HLA-DR, and CD45 with kappa light chain restriction. Unlike typical PEL/BCBL, human herpesvirus type 8/Kaposi sarcoma herpes virus (HHV-8/KSHV) genomic sequence was not present in the lymphoma cells and there was no serologic evidence of human
immunodeficiency
virus (HIV) infection. This is the fourth reported case of HHV-8 negative, HIV negative PEL/BCBL in a patient with associated HCV-related cirrhosis and review of these cases showed some consistent clinicopathological features, i.e. exclusive involvement of the peritoneal cavity and phenotypic expression of B-cell associated antigens in contrast to the generally null phenotype PEL/BCBL. The occurrence of these cases suggests that HCV may play an etiological role in a subcategory of PEL/BCBL not associated with HHV-8.

Primary effusion lymphoma (PEL) is recognized as a unique clinicopathological entity associated with human herpesvirus 8 (HHV-8), and it occurs almost exclusively in human
immunodeficiency
virus (HIV)-infected individuals. In the majority of PEL cases, Epstein-Barr virus (EBV) has been found in the tumor cells as well. We describe here an elderly HIV seronegative female patient with PEL in the pleura and pericardium not associated with HHV-8 or EBV. Cytologic examinations of the pleural effusion revealed large lymphoma cells with immunophenotypes positive for CD8,
CD10
, CD19, CD20, CD22, CD24, CD45, and HLA-DR but negative for CD30 and surface immunoglobulin. Chromosome analysis showed complicated abnormalities including add(3)(q27). Immunoglobulin gene rearrangement was detected by Southern blotting; however, c-myc, Bcl-2, and Bcl-6 genes were not rearranged. The patient was treated with a modified CHOP (cyclophosphamide, hydroxydoxorubicin, oncovine, and prednisolone) regimen, and achieved remission. Recurrence of PEL in the pericardium as effusion lymphoma was found 3 months after the discontinuation of CHOP. After approximately 1 year of intermittent multiagent salvage therapy for pericardial recurrences, a treatment that resulted in a partial response, 3 cycles of monotherapy with sobuzoxane were administered. At the time of this report the patient had been free from PEL for more than 18 months without chemotherapy.

We report a case of primary effusion lymphoma (PEL) in a 75-year-old woman without human
immunodeficiency
virus or hepatitis C virus, which presented as fever, chest pain, and pericardial effusion. The lymphoma cells were positive for CD20 and CD79a, and were negative for CD3 and
CD10
. Genomic human herpes virus 8 (HHV-8) and Epstein-Barr virus were not detected in the lymphoma cells. Cytogenetic analysis showed complex abnormalities by the G-banding technique, and spectral karyotyping (SKY) analysis provided more detailed characterization of the chromosomal aberrations, including t(1;22)(q21;q11) and t(14;17)(q32;q23). We did not detect C-MYC gene rearrangement or BCL-2 expression. She was treated successfully with six courses of the CHOP regimen. The present case demonstrated a rare category of PEL that is not associated with HHV-8 or C-MYC gene rearrangement. In addition, SKY analysis disclosed cryptic chromosomal abnormalities involving 1q21 and 17q23.

Wiskott-Aldrich syndrome (WAS) is an X-linked
immunodeficiency
/platelet disease due to mutations of WASP, a cytoskeletal regulatory protein of blood cells. Patients exhibit a range of immune defects generally attributed to defective T-cell function, including poor response to immunization, skewed immunoglobulin isotypes, eczema, recurrent infections, autoimmune disease and increased frequency of malignancies. Here we show a deficit of total B-cells in WAS patients of various ages and identify phenotypic perturbations involving complement receptors and CD27. Whereas B-cells of normal healthy donors are overwhelmingly CD21/CD35-positive, B-cells expressing these receptors are significantly reduced in number in WAS patients, and their paucity may cause suboptimal antigen capture and presentation. The frequencies of IgD(-) and IgG(+) patient B-cells were not different from healthy donors (although absolute numbers were decreased), indicating that isotype switching is occurring. In contrast, the frequency of cells positive for CD27, the marker of post germinal centre B-cells, was significantly decreased even among isotype-switched cells, and B-cells resembling germinal centre progenitors (
CD10
(+)CD27(-)CD38(bright)) were more frequent in adult patients, suggesting impaired germinal centre maturation/differentiation. The documentation of these phenotypic perturbations and deficit of total cells suggest that defects intrinsic to B-cells contribute to the impaired humoral immunity that characterizes this disease.

We report an instructive case of diffuse large B-cell lymphoma presenting as acute heart failure. A 69-year-old human
immunodeficiency
virus-negative man was admitted to our hospital for general fatigue. A computed tomographic scan of the chest and abdomen showed pericardial effusion, but there was no evidence of tumor masses, lymph node enlargement, or hepatosplenomegaly. During the chemotherapy, increased lactate dehydrogenase and pleural effusion appeared. The tumor cells in the effusion showed positivity for CD5, CD19, CD20, kappa chain, and Bcl-2 and negativity for
CD10
and CD23. The chromosomes showed t(8;14)(q24;q32) with c-myc/immunoglobulin (Ig)H rearrangement, and the MIB-1 index was not high (60%). Neither human herpes virus 8 nor Epstein-Barr virus DNA was detected in the cells by polymerase chain reaction. The response to chemotherapy was very poor, and the patient died 4 months after the diagnosis. A spectrum of the symptoms of CD5+ lymphoma encompasses pericardial effusion and also can accompany c-myc/IgH rearrangement.

X-linked lymphoproliferative disease (XLP) is a severe
immunodeficiency
associated with a marked reduction in circulating memory B cells. Our investigation of the B cell compartment of XLP patients revealed an increase in the frequency of a population of B cells distinct from those previously defined. This population displayed increased expression of
CD10
, CD24, and CD38, indicating that it could consist of circulating immature/transitional B cells. Supporting this possibility, CD10+CD24highCD38high B cells displayed other immature characteristics, including unmutated Ig V genes and elevated levels of surface IgM; they also lacked expression of Bcl-2 and a panel of activation molecules. The capacity of CD24highCD38high B cells to proliferate, secrete Ig, and migrate in vitro was greatly reduced compared with mature B cell populations. Moreover, CD24highCD38high B cells were increased in the peripheral blood of neonates, patients with common variable
immunodeficiency
, and patients recovering from hemopoietic stem cell transplant. Thus, an expansion of functionally immature B cells may contribute to the humoral immunodeficient state that is characteristic of neonates, as well as patients with XLP or common variable
immunodeficiency
, and those recovering from a stem cell transplant. Further investigation of transitional B cells will improve our understanding of human B cell development and how alterations to this process may precipitate
immunodeficiency
or autoimmunity.

Collapsing focal segmental glomerulosclerosis (cFSGS) is characterized by hyperplasia of glomerular epithelial cells. In a mouse model of FSGS and in a patient with recurrent idiopathic FSGS, we identified the proliferating cells as parietal epithelial cells (PECs). In the present study, we have evaluated the origin of the proliferating cells in cFSGS associated with human
immunodeficiency
virus (HIV) and pamidronate. We performed a detailed study of glomerular lesions in biopsies of two patients with HIV-associated cFSGS and a nephrectomy specimen of a patient with pamidronate-associated cFSGS. Glomeruli were studied by serial sectioning using light and electron microscopy and immunohistochemistry to determine the epithelial cell phenotype. We used Synaptopodin, vascular endothelial growth factor, and
CD10
as podocyte markers, CK8 and PAX2 as PEC markers and Ki-67 as marker of cell proliferation. The newly deposited extracellular matrix was characterized using antiheparan sulfate single-chain antibodies. The proliferating cells were negative for the podocyte markers, but stained positive for the PEC markers and the cell proliferation marker Ki-67. The proliferating PAX-2 and CK8 positive cells that covered the capillary tuft were always in continuity with PAX-2/CK8 positive cells lining Bowman's capsule. The matrix deposited by these proliferating cells stained identically to Bowman's capsule. Our study demonstrates that PECs proliferate in HIV and pamidronate-associated cFSGS. Our data do not support the concept of the proliferating, dedifferentiated podocyte.

The most common type of primary testicular lymphoma is diffuse large B-cell type, which has the potential for aggressive clinical behavior. Diffuse large B-cell lymphoma can be further subclassified into two major prognostic categories: germinal center B-cell-like and nongerminal center B-cell-like. Such distinction is made possible using the immunohistochemical expression of
CD10
, Bcl-6 and MUM1. The aim of this study was to stratify primary testicular lymphoma of the diffuse large B-cell type according to this scheme. Immunohistochemical stains for
CD10
, Bcl-6 and MUM1 were performed on 18 cases of primary testicular lymphoma of diffuse large B-cell type. Subclassification was carried out as previously described where
CD10
and/or Bcl-6 positivity and negativity for MUM1 were considered indicative of germinal center B-cell-like type and the opposite expression as nongerminal center B-cell-like type. The proliferative activity was determined using immunostaining with the Ki-67 antibody. Of 18 cases, 16 (89%) were found to belong to the nongerminal center B-cell-like type. Two cases (11%) were classified as germinal center B-cell-like type; one had a
CD10
-positive, Bcl-6-positive and MUM1-negative profile, and the other was
CD10
negative, Bcl-6 positive and MUM1 negative. The former occurred in a 38-year-old patient who was human
immunodeficiency
virus positive. All the cases expressed high proliferative activity (> or =50% Ki-67 labeling). We conclude that most (89%) primary testicular lymphomas of the diffuse large B-cell type belong to the nongerminal center B-cell-like subgroup and have high proliferative activity.

The heterogeneity of the posttransplant lymphoproliferative disorders (PTLDs) is well recognized. However, in contrast to other
immunodeficiency
-associated lymphomas or diffuse large B-cell lymphomas in general, studies of the histogenetic spectrum of the large category of monomorphic B-cell cases have been more limited, produced conflicting results, and have paid little attention to the impact of Epstein-Barr virus (EBV). Therefore, 30 monomorphic B-cell PTLD from 27 patients were analyzed using EBER in situ hybridization for EBV and a panel of antibodies directed against CD20, CD3/bcl-6,
CD10
, MUM-1/IRF4, CD138, and bcl-2. The results were correlated with the histopathologic features and clinical outcome. All PTLD were CD20 with 23%
CD10
, 53% bcl-6, 67% MUM-1/IRF4, 13% CD138, 83% bcl-2 and 67% EBV. 30% of the PTLD had a germinal center (GC) profile (
CD10
, bcl-6, MUM-1/IRF4, CD138), 53% a "late GC/early post-GC" profile (
CD10
, bcl-6, MUM-1/IRF4, CD138), 13% a post-GC profile (
CD10
, bcl-6, MUM-1/IRF4, CD138) and 3% an indeterminate profile (all markers negative). EBV positivity was associated with MUM-1/IRF4 expression (P=0.005) and with a non-GC phenotype (P=0.01). All CD138 cases were EBV. The cases with a GC phenotype were the most likely to resemble transformed GC cells (P=0.023). No statistically significant survival differences could be documented between those with a GC versus non-GC phenotype. These results highlight the broad histogenetic spectrum of monomorphic B-cell PTLD. They demonstrate the association of EBV positivity with a non-GC phenotype and suggest that EBV PTLD are more like lymphomas that arise in immunocompetent individuals. The lack of a demonstrable correlation with survival may relate to the relatively small number of cases studied.
